Kogi Stakeholder Highlights Insecurity's Impact on Farmers
Hon. Suberu Yusuf John, a stakeholder from Kogi State, highlighted the severe impact of insecurity on local communities, particularly in Adavi Local Government.
He noted that farmers are abandoning their farms due to threats from banditry, and children are forced to learn under trees due to overcrowded classrooms. During a declaration on Wednesday, he expressed his intent to contest for the House of Representatives seat for Adavi Okehi Federal Constituency, emphasizing the need for leadership that understands the community's pain and aspirations.
He acknowledged the recent efforts of Governor Ahm Usman Ododo in addressing road challenges but lamented the overall dire conditions affecting the community, including unemployment and inadequate infrastructure. Hon.
John called for constituents to choose representatives who genuinely care for their welfare. He also mentioned the support pledged by Hon.
Abdulmalik Fatimat for his aspirations, highlighting the importance of true leadership that uplifts the community.
